The new PE seats currently being fitted by VS are far and away the best of their kind (to be fair the old ones weren't)
I have sat in the new PE seats and I was impressed. The leather is the same as that used in the J suites and gives a much classier feel to the cabin. The seats are more adjustable and VS now offer a vastly upgraded service (previously it was basically economy meals and amenities) featuring catering and crockery excusive to premium economy.
These should be on all the B744 fleet by next spring. With this in mind the extra is definately worth it.
